Abstract

To provide a transition metal-containing hydroxide, which is a precursor of a lithium-containing composite oxide, with which it is possible to obtain a lithium ion secondary battery excellent in the discharge capacity and cycle characteristics, by using as a cathode active material a lithium-containing composite oxide obtained from the hydroxide. A transition metal-containing hydroxide, which is a precursor of a lithium-containing composite oxide, wherein in a distribution of the logarithmic derivative pore specific surface area relative to the pore size, obtained by BJH method, the proportion of the sum of the logarithmic derivative pore specific surface areas with pore sizes of 10 nm or larger, to 100% of the sum of the logarithmic derivative pore specific surface areas in the entire distribution, is at least 23%.

Claims (10)

1. A transition metal-containing hydroxide, which is a precursor of a lithium-containing composite oxide, wherein in a distribution of a logarithmic derivative pore specific surface area relative to pore size, obtained by a Barrett, Joyner, Halenda (BJH) method, a proportion of a sum of the logarithmic derivative pore specific surface areas with pore sizes of 10 nm or larger, to 100% of a sum of the logarithmic derivative pore specific surface areas in an entire distribution, is at least 23% and at most 33.7%;

wherein the transition metal-containing hydroxide has a BET specific surface area from 55 m 2 /g to 200 m 2 /g, and

wherein in a distribution of the logarithmic derivative pore specific surface area relative to the pore size, obtained by the BJH method, the sum of the logarithmic derivative pore specific surface areas with pore sizes of 10 nm or larger, is at least 300 m 2 /g and at most 400 m 2 /g.

2. The transition metal-containing hydroxide according to claim 1 , which is a transition metal-containing hydroxide represented by the following formula (1):

Ni α Co β Mn γ M δ (OH) 2   formula (1)

wherein M is a metal element other than Li, Ni, Co and Mn, α is from 0.15 to 0.5, β is from 0 to 0.2, γ is from 0.3 to 0.8, δ is from 0 to 0.1, and α+β+γ+δ=1.

3. The transition metal-containing hydroxide according to claim 1 , wherein D 50 of the transition metal-containing hydroxide is from 3.5 to 15.5 μm.

4. The transition metal-containing hydroxide according to claim 1 , wherein the transition metal-containing hydroxide has a BET specific surface area from 70 m 2 /g to 100 m 2 /g.

5. The transition metal-containing hydroxide according to claim 1 , wherein D 50 of the transition metal-containing hydroxide is from 3.5 to 8.0 μm.

6. A method for producing a lithium-containing composite oxide, which comprises a step of mixing the transition metal-containing hydroxide as defined in claim 1 and a lithium compound, and firing the mixture at 900° C. or higher.
